Stability Analysis And Control Of Markov Jump Time Delay Systems

As a special kind of hybrid system,Markov jump system is more and more widely used in social life,such as the application in aircraft control system,in the medical system to predict the development trend of disease,as well as in the economic system for the prediction of market share and sales expected profit forecast,so the research on the stability and control of Markov jump system appears especially important.In addition,the time-varying delay phenomenon is common in Markov jump system,which usually causes system instability and affects the performance of the system.Therefore,it is realistic to explore the control problem of Markov jump system with time-varying time delay.Meaning and theoretical value.The study of the control problem of Markov jump system with time-varying time delay is more relistic and theoretical.This paper uses Lyapunov functional and linear matrix inequalities to studying the slid-ing mode control of generalized Markov jump systems and the random sampled-data control of Markov jump systems.The main work is as follows:Firstly,the stochastic admissibility of generalized Markov jump systems with time-varying delays is studied.By constructing an integral sliding mode switching function,combining the Wirtinger inequality and the formula based on the extension of the Wirtinger inequality,some sufficient conditions for random admissibility are derived.Then the slid-ing mode controller and switching rules are designed so that the state trajectory reaches the sliding mode surface in a limited time,thereby obtaining stable sliding mode dynamics.Secondly,this paper considered the sliding mode control problem of generalized Markov jump system with time-varying delay and disturbance.By establish an integral sliding mode surface and design an equivalent controller,then construct a Lyapunov functional with triple integral terms,use Jensen's inequality and more accurate scaling methods,the corresponding controller gain matrix and H? Performance are obtained.Finally,the random sampling control problem of Markov system with time-varying delay and disturbance is discussed.Design a random sampling controller,construct a Lya-punov functional related to the sampling information,use the extended formula based on the Wirtinger inequality,some sufficient conditions are obtained for the asymptotic stability of the system.And then the convex combination technique is useed to solve the system's H?performance index.
